Probabilistic Risk Assessment of Endocrine Disrupting Pesticides in Iran abstract

The chronic diet risk for 34 pesticides was assessed by comparing TMDI with the Acceptable Daily Intakes (ADI)evaluated by FAO and 6 pesticides had TMDI > ADI. HIs or total HQs in apple were 1.81 for adults and 2.82 forchildren due to EDPs residue as well as, HI in citrus due to EDPs residue were 1.11 and 1.73 in adults and children.HI of cucumber consumption in children was 1.28, and 1.47 for lettuce, in potato it was 1.38, in rice 1.23 and tomatoit was 1.29 more than acceptable level. HQ in wheat was 17.40 and 20.29 in adults and children, respectively. Due todimethoate residue in wheat, HQ was 2.78, and for fenitrothion residue 3.22. HI was 21.22 for adults and 24.76 forchildren in wheat, more than 1.Total Carcinogenic risk (TCR) due to EDPs residues was 6.40×10-5 in apple, in citrusfruits was 5.97×10-5, 3.33×10-5 in cucumber, 5.30×10-5 in lettuce, in potato was 2.36×10-5, in rice was 1.61×10-5,1.78×10-5 in tomato, and due to epoxiconazole residues in wheat was 3.18×10-5, more than acceptable limit 1.0×10-6.Therefore, consumers were at significant risk of carcinogenesis in these products.
